Output 28659fab79b6c89094296bbb64616c1e2ab69a2aa2734a784e354b8145aa867d:1

value
371136
script pubkey
OP_0 OP_PUSHBYTES_20 7416de44df2336c52434757e4e44621b83fb5904
address
ltc1qwstdu3xlyvmv2fp5w4lyu3rzrwplkkgyz570av
transaction
28659fab79b6c89094296bbb64616c1e2ab69a2aa2734a784e354b8145aa867d
spent
true